农村集中式供水一体化净水设备工艺与技术性能比较分析  被引量:4

摘  要:从工艺与技术性能方面对多介质过滤、中空纤维膜超滤及旋转平板膜超滤这3种目前在我国农村集中式供水饮用水净化得到广泛使用的净水技术进行了介绍与比较。总体而言,多介质过滤工艺属于传统技术,受前期经济技术水平限制,出水水质远低于另外两种超滤膜净水工艺;旋转式平板膜超滤工艺与中空纤维膜超滤工艺相比,两者出水水质接近,都能在去除大部分有害物质同时保留人体需要的元素,但旋转式平板膜超滤工艺具有后发技术优势,对水源要求低,抗污堵能力强,膜使用寿命更长,综合技术经济指标明显占优,适用于农村集中供水,该项技术也适用于城镇水厂水质提升改造。Multi-media filtration, hollow fiber membrane ultrafiltration and rotating flat membrane ultrafiltration are widely adopted for rural central drinking water purification and supply system. These three kinds of water purification technology were compared in respects of technique and performance. Multi-media filtration is generally traditional technique and limited by former technical and economic level, which leads to the worst water quality. The rest two technologies render similar water quality, capable of removing most harmful substance while keeping the elements required by human body. With the technical advantages of low water source requirements, strong ability of resisting pollution and plugging, long service life of membrane, rotating flat membrane ultrafihration technology is superior in aspects of comprehensive technical and economic indexes, and is suitable for rural central water supply and water quality upgrade of township water plant.
